UNEMPLOYMENT was unchanged in February from a month earlier but job quality improved, the Philippine Statistics Authority (PSA) reported on Tuesday.

The country's jobless rate stayed at 4.8 percent while underemployment — those looking for more work or an extra job — improved to 12.9 percent from 14.1 percent in January.A year earlier, unemployment was higher at 6.4 percent and underemployment was at 14.0 percent.Employment was also unchanged month-on-month at 95.2 percent but improved from February 2022's 93.6 percent.The number of Filipinos with jobs rose to 48.8 million from 47.35 million in January and 45.

'The lifting of various restrictions that previously impeded employment opportunities has resulted in an increase in job prospects for Filipino workers,' he added.The National Economic and Development Authority particularly noted an improvement in unemployment among the youth — those aged 15 to 24 — which dropped to 9.1 percent from 14.2 percent a year earlier.It also pointed out that the labor force participation rate had risen to 66.6 percent from 63.8 percent year on year.
